CSM - Fans of the animated Ice Age films can now play around with their favorite prehistoric pals in Ice Age: Continental Drift: Arctic Games, a multiplatform game starring Manny, Sid, Diego, and others. The story tells of a secret treasure that has fallen into the hands of the Ice Age crew, and so they decide to compete in a series of wacky winter sporting events to see who will keep the riches.
